What does Wallace Flatware make?

Wallace Flatware makes a variety of high end flatware/cutlery sets and is famous for it's line of sterling silver flatware dating back to the early 1800's. They also manufacture less expensive but high quality flatware sets using stainless steel as well.


What does I S mean on silver flatware after a manufacturer's name?

IS stands for the International Silver Co. and unless it says sterling or 925/1000 it is silver plate.

What does IS mean on silver ware?

The "IS" silver marking on flatware stands for "International Silver Company". The flatware is silver plated. Visit the link below for details about other silver markings too.


Which should I choose first My china set or my flatware set?

If you opt for more elaborate flatware, such as sterling silver, then you should pick out your flatware first. For stainless steel flatware, pick your china first and then buy flatware that compliments the chosen china.


What does Prunus in Prunus Solingen flatware mean?

It is the design or pattern and Solingen is the town in Germany where it was made.


What does the cube mark on oneida stainless mean?

Oneida sterling flatware had a mark with a "cube" on the left side of the name. According to my reference, it is "The silver cube. Our silversmiths' mark of excellence," and was used since 1965. The cube is apparently a mark of excellence. (American Sterling Silver Flatware, by Maryanne Dolan.)
